到 2029 年,全球工程机械轮胎市场规模有望达到 61.1 亿美元

由于非公路车辆销量的增加和农业机械化的提高,全球工程机械轮胎市场正在获得牵引力。

领先的战略咨询和市场研究公司 BlueWeave Consulting 最近估计,2022 年全球工程机械轮胎市场规模为 36.5 亿美元。 2023-2029年预测期内,全球工程机械轮胎市场规模预计将以7.80%的复合年复合成长率增长,预计到2029年将达到61.1亿美元。城市化和工业化的加速,特别是在发展中国家,农业现代化程度的提高,特别是在新兴国家,以及全球对现代农用车辆的需求不断增长,都是推动全球非公路(OTR)轮胎市场的主要增长因素。

Global OTR Tires Market Size Booming to Touch USD 6.11 Billion by 2029

The global OTR Tires market is gaining traction because of the increase in the sales of off-highway vehicles and rising farm mechanization.

BlueWeave Consulting, a leading strategic consulting and market research firm, in its recent study, estimated the global OTR Tires market size at USD 3.65 billion in 2022. During the forecast period between 2023 and 2029, the global OTR Tires market size is projected to grow at an impressive CAGR of 7.80% reaching a value of USD 6.11 billion by 2029. Accelerated urbanization and industrialization, particularly in developing countries, as well as the rising modernization of farms, particularly in emerging countries, and the rising demand for modern agricultural vehicles globally are all major growth factors for the global off-the-road (OTR) tires market.

Global OTR Tires Market - Overview:

OTR tires are a type of off-road tire that is used to provide more traction on unpaved surfaces, such as loose dirt, mud, sand, or gravel. These tires, which are typically radial with thick, deep treads, are intended for use in both on- and off-road vehicles. OTR tires that can perform in harsh conditions without sacrificing safety, quality, or performance are required for heavy-duty equipment and vehicles. OTR tires have been used in a wide range of industrial applications, including aircraft tow vehicles, articulated dump trucks, container handlers, and others.

Global OTR Tires Market - By Distribution Channel:

Based on the distribution channel, the global OTR Tires market is segmented into OEM and aftermarket. The OEM segment accounts for the largest market share. OEM businesses deal directly with their clients. They are therefore better equipped to create goods that fulfill the demands of their customers. This frequently results in parts that are stronger and survive longer than those made by aftermarket manufacturers. However, the aftermarkets segment is projected to register a high growth rate during the forecast period owing to the rising demand for replacement tires from the end-user industries.

Impact of COVID-19 on the Global OTR Tires Market

The global market for OTR tires experienced a substantial slowdown during the COVID-19 outbreak. During the lockdown period, the OTR tire supply and manufacturing chains were hampered. Restrictions on cross-border trade to stop the virus' spread also completely disrupted the supply chain. The operation of the main end users, such as construction, mining, and agriculture, was also halted, which had a direct influence on the demand from OEMs and aftermarkets for OTR tires.

Competitive Landscape:

Major players operating in the global OTR Tires market include: Continental AG, Bridgestone Corporation, MICHELIN, The Goodyear Tire & Rubber Company, Yokohama Tire Corporation, Hankook Tire & Technology Co., Ltd., Nokian Tyres plc., Apollo Tyres Ltd, KUMHO TIRE, Pirelli & C. S.p.A., Toyo Tire Corporation, Trelleborg AB, Prometeon Tyre Group S.R.L., JK TYRE & INDUSTRIES LTD., and Triangle Tire.

To further enhance their market share, these companies employ various strategies, including mergers and acquisitions, partnerships, joint ventures, license agreements, and new product launches.
